在Debian系统优化Filebeat网络传输可从配置、系统资源、网络参数等方面入手,具体如下:
filebeat.yml中设置output.elasticsearch.bulk_max_size,增大每批发送的数据量,减少网络请求次数。output.elasticsearch.compression: gzip,降低传输数据大小。output.elasticsearch.hosts。/etc/security/limits.conf,提升Filebeat进程的文件描述符可用量。file_input),提高数据读取速度。/etc/sysctl.conf,调整net.core.rmem_max、net.core.wmem_max等参数,提升网络传输性能。filebeat.yml中通过network.host指定监听的IP地址,避免不必要的网络流量。